header,.header-left,.nav-links,.search-cart{display:flex;align-items:center}header{justify-content:space-between;padding:10px 20px;position:sticky;top:0;background:var(--header-background);-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);z-index:100;box-shadow:0 2px 5px #0000001a}.header-left,.nav-links{gap:1.5rem}.search-cart{gap:1rem}.logo img{height:30px;width:auto}.nav-links a{position:relative;font-family:Roboto,sans-serif;font-size:18px;color:var(--header-text);text-decoration:none;transition:color .3s}.nav-links a.active{color:var(--primary)!important}.nav-links a:not(.cart-icon):not(.logout-button):after{content:"";position:absolute;bottom:0;left:0;width:100%;height:1px;background-color:var(--primary);transform:scaleX(0);transform-origin:left;transition:transform .3s ease-in-out}.nav-links a:not(.cart-icon):not(.logout-button):hover:after{transform:scaleX(1)}.nav-links a:hover{color:var(--primary)}.search-cart a.cart-icon,.search-cart .login-icon,.search-cart .logout-button,.search-cart .theme-toggle-button,.search-cart .user-toggle{display:inline-flex;align-items:center;justify-content:center;background:none;border:none;padding:0;cursor:pointer;line-height:1;text-decoration:none;transition:color .3s ease-in-out,transform .2s ease-in-out}.search-cart svg{color:var(--body-text);transition:color .3s ease-in-out,transform .2s ease-in-out}.search-cart a.cart-icon:hover svg,.search-cart a.cart-icon:hover,.search-cart .login-icon:hover svg,.search-cart .logout-button:hover svg,.search-cart .user-picture-small:hover{transform:scale(1.1)}.search-cart a.cart-icon:active svg,.search-cart a.cart-icon:active,.search-cart .login-icon:active svg,.search-cart .logout-button:active svg,.search-cart .user-picture-small:active{transform:scale(.9)}.search-cart a.cart-icon:hover svg{color:var(--primary-hover)}.search-cart a.cart-icon.active svg{color:var(--primary)!important}.search-cart .logout-form{display:inline-flex;align-items:center}.menu-toggle{display:none;background:none;border:none;font-size:32px;cursor:pointer}.user-links{display:flex;flex-direction:column;position:absolute;opacity:0;visibility:hidden;transition:opacity .3s ease,visibility .3s ease;pointer-events:none;top:78px;right:20px;height:auto;border-radius:10px;align-items:flex-start;padding:20px 20px 10px;box-shadow:0 4px 10px #00000040;width:270px;border:.5px solid var(--border);background:var(--card-background)}.user-links.open{opacity:1;visibility:visible;pointer-events:auto}.user-links .userinfo{display:flex;flex-direction:row;align-items:center;gap:8px;margin-bottom:8px}.user-text{display:flex;flex-direction:column}.userinfo strong{color:var(--header-text);font-size:16px}.userinfo p{color:var(--body-p);font-size:12px}.user-links .separador-slim{height:.5px;width:100%;background-color:var(--border);margin-top:10px;margin-bottom:10px}.user-buttons>*:last-child{margin-bottom:0}.user-buttons{margin-left:-10px;margin-right:-10px}.user-buttons .separador-slim{width:calc(100% - 20px);margin-left:10px}.user-links .btn-component{font-size:15px}.user-picture{width:35px;height:35px;border-radius:50%;background:var(--secondary);align-content:center}.user-picture-small{width:30px;height:30px;border-radius:50%;background:var(--secondary);color:#fff;display:flex;align-items:center;justify-content:center;transition:transform .2s ease-in-out;font-size:16px;line-height:1}.user-picture p{justify-self:center;font-family:Roboto-Condensed,sans-serif;font-size:18px;color:#fff;text-align:center}#toggle-dark .icon-dark,[data-theme=dark] #toggle-dark .icon-light{display:none}[data-theme=dark] #toggle-dark .icon-dark{display:inline}.cart-badge{position:absolute;top:-4px;right:-4px;background-color:var(--primary);color:#fff;font-size:12px;border-radius:9999px;font-weight:regular;width:19px;height:19px;text-align:center;align-content:center;border:1px solid var(--card-background)}.cart-icon{position:relative}@media (max-width: 768px){header{padding:20px}.nav-links{position:absolute;top:90px;left:0;flex-direction:column;width:180px;height:auto;padding:1rem;background:var(--mobile-menu-background);border-radius:5px;align-items:flex-start;gap:20px;box-shadow:0 4px 10px #00000040;border:.5px solid var(--border);transform:translate(-100%);transition:transform .3s ease-in-out;display:flex}.nav-links.open{transform:translate(0)}.nav-links a{width:auto;text-align:left}.menu-toggle{display:inline-flex;position:absolute;left:1rem;top:50%;transform:translateY(-50%);z-index:102}.logo{position:absolute;left:50%;transform:translate(-50%)}.logo img{align-items:center;justify-content:center;display:flex;width:45px;height:45px}.search-cart .menu-toggle,.search-cart a.cart-icon,.search-cart .login-icon,.search-cart .logout-form,.search-cart .user-toggle{display:inline-flex}.user-links{top:90px}}
